I lost my iPhone can I find back ?

Unless you enabled Find My iPhone on it before it was lost then there isn't any way to locate it. If you did enable it then you could try locating it either via http://icloud.com on a computer or Find My iPhone / Find My iPad on another device - but that will only work if it's connected to a network and the device hasn't already been wiped and/or Find My iPhone disabled on it.
If you think that it was stolen then you should report it to the police. You should also contact your carrier and change your iTunes account password, your email account passwords, and any passwords that you'd stored on websites/emails/notes etc.

    I can't find email messages stored on the mail server
    If you have an IMAP email account and you set the account preferences to store copies of messages (draft, sent, junk, or trash) on the IMAP mail server, you might experience situations in which your messages are not stored where you expected.
    When Mail attempts to store messages on the server, it looks for specific mailboxes, by name, in which to put the messages. If Mail doesn't find those mailboxes on the server, it tries to create them. If Mail can't create them on the server, it can't store the messages. For example, Mail looks on the server for a mailbox called Sent Messages in which to put the sent messages. If Mail can't find a Sent Messages mailbox on the server, it tries to create one. If it cannot, it doesn't save copies of messages you send. You might be able to address this issue if there is another mailbox on the IMAP server (for example, Sent Items) that contains the messages you're looking for. You can have Mail use that mailbox to store its sent messages. To do so, select that mailbox (listed under the account's name and icon) in the Mail viewer window, choose Mailbox > Use This Mailbox For and then choose Drafts, Junk, Sent, or Trash, as applicable. You can select any mailbox on your IMAP server to use to store draft, sent, junk, or deleted messages.
    If you change the account preferences to no longer store copies of messages on the mail server, you'll see that messages aren't where they used to be. To use sent messages as an example: If you were saving sent messages on the server and then change your settings to save those messages on your computer, the Sent mailbox will change to contain only messages stored on your computer; messages that were stored on the server will no longer appear in that mailbox. Instead, you'll see those messages are now located under the account's name and icon at the bottom of the list of mailboxes, in a mailbox called Sent Messages. Similarly, if you change from saving sent messages on your computer to saving them on the server, the Sent Messages mailbox will change to contain only messages stored on the server. You'll now see the messages that were saved on your computer in a mailbox called Sent Messages, followed by the account name in parentheses, such as Sent Messages (.Mac Account).
